🥇1. Banarasi Silk Saree
A true symbol of heritage and elegance, the Banarasi silk saree is known for its intricate gold and silver zari work. Originally woven in Varanasi, this saree is perfect for weddings and festive occasions.
✨ Best for: Bridal wear, wedding guests

🥈 2. Kanjivaram Saree
Known for its rich silk and traditional temple borders, the Kanjivaram saree (also called Kanchipuram saree) is one of the most durable and luxurious sarees a woman can own.
✨ Best for: Religious ceremonies, family functions

🥉 3. Chanderi Saree
Light, sheer, and elegant — the Chanderi saree is ideal for summer wear and formal office settings. It blends minimalism with regal charm.
✨ Best for: Office parties, day events

🧵 4. Tussar Silk Saree
With a natural gold sheen and rich texture, Tussar silk sarees are eco-friendly and exude earthy elegance. A favorite among women who love understated luxury.
✨ Best for: Day weddings, poojas
